Strongygaster
''Strongygaster'' is a genus of Fly, flies in the family Tachinidae. Species *''Strongygaster argentinensis'' (Émile Blanchard, Blanchard, 1942) *''Strongygaster brasiliensis'' (Charles Henry Tyler Townsend, Townsend, 1929) *''Strongygaster californica'' (Charles Henry Tyler Townsend, Townsend, 1908) *''Strongygaster celer'' (Johann Wilhelm Meigen, Meigen, 1838) *''Strongygaster didyma'' (Hermann Loew, Loew, 1863) *''Strongygaster globula'' (Johann Wilhelm Meigen, Meigen, 1824) *''Strongygaster nishijimai'' Mesnil, 1957 *''Strongygaster robusta'' (Charles Henry Tyler Townsend, Townsend, 1908) *''Strongygaster triangulifera'' (Hermann Loew, Loew, 1863) References

Strongygaster Triangulifera
''Strongygaster triangulifera'' is a species of bristle fly in the family Tachinidae. It is a generalist parasitoid of adult insects, including Coleoptera from over 10 families, as well as Dermaptera, Hemiptera, Lepidoptera, and Orthoptera Orthoptera () is an order of insects that comprises the grasshoppers, locusts, and crickets, including closely related insects, such as the bush crickets or katydids and wētā. Pierre-Justin-Marie Macquart
Pierre-Justin-Marie Macquart (8 April 1778 – 25 November 1855) was a French entomologist specialising in the study of Diptera. He worked on world species as well as European and described many new species. Biography Early years Macquart was born in Hazebrouck, France, in 1778 and died in Lille in 1855. He was interested in natural history from an early age due to his older brother who was an ornithologist and a Fellow of the Société de Sciences de l’Agriculture et des Arts de la Ville de Lille and whose bird collection became the foundation of the societies museum, the Musée d'Histoire Naturelle de Lille. A second brother founded a botanic garden with a collection of over 3000 species of plants. Macquart, too became interested in natural history. In 1796 he joined the staff of General Armand Samuel then campaigning in the French Revolutionary Wars: Campaigns of 1796, Revolutionary Wars. He was a secretary and draftsman. Diptera Of North America
Flies are insects of the order Diptera, the name being derived from the Greek δι- ''di-'' "two", and πτερόν ''pteron'' "wing". Insects of this order use only a single pair of wings to fly, the hindwings having evolved into advanced mechanosensory organs known as halteres, which act as high-speed sensors of rotational movement and allow dipterans to perform advanced aerobatics. Diptera is a large order containing an estimated 1,000,000 species including horse-flies, crane flies, hoverflies and others, although only about 125,000 species have been described. Flies have a mobile head, with a pair of large compound eyes, and mouthparts designed for piercing and sucking (mosquitoes, black flies and robber flies), or for lapping and sucking in the other groups. Their wing arrangement gives them great maneuverability in flight, and claws and pads on their feet enable them to cling to smooth surfaces.
